#51bc2f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#51bc2f is composed of 31.8% red, 73.7%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 75%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 46.1%. #51bc2f color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ff5e with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#51bc2f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#51bc2f has RGB values of R:81, G:188,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5356591.

Shades and Tints of #51bc2f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#51bc2f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727d6e is the less saturated color, while #3ae902 is the most saturated one.
